About Annulment Law in Varna, Bulgaria

Annulment is a legal procedure that declares a marriage null and void, as if it never happened. In Varna, Bulgaria, annulment is governed by specific laws and procedures that must be followed to dissolve a marriage in this way.

Local Laws Overview

In Varna, Bulgaria, annulment may be granted under specific circumstances such as fraud, bigamy, incapacity to consent to marriage, or if the marriage was entered into under duress. The court will review the evidence presented and make a decision based on the law.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. Can anyone file for an annulment in Varna, Bulgaria?

Only certain individuals who meet the legal requirements for annulment can file a petition with the court.

2. What are the grounds for annulment in Varna, Bulgaria?

Grounds for annulment may include fraud, bigamy, incapacity to consent to marriage, or coercion.

3. How long does the annulment process take in Varna, Bulgaria?

The duration of the annulment process can vary depending on the circumstances of the case and the court's schedule.

4. What happens to children in an annulment in Varna, Bulgaria?

The court will make decisions regarding child custody, support, and visitation based on the best interests of the child.

5. Do I need to appear in court for an annulment in Varna, Bulgaria?

You may need to appear in court for hearings or if the court requires your testimony.

6. Can I get spousal support in an annulment in Varna, Bulgaria?

The court may award spousal support based on the circumstances of the case and the financial needs of the parties involved.

7. Can I remarry after an annulment in Varna, Bulgaria?

Once the annulment is granted and finalized, you are free to remarry in Varna, Bulgaria.
